Although they should have taken place last summer, the last three concerts of Mylène Farmer’s “Nevermore” tour had been postponed because of the riots which affected Paris following the death of Nahel. It was therefore this Friday, September 27 that the singer performed at the Stade de France, for her first performance of the series in this legendary venue.
Impatient, many fans camped for several days in front of the Stadium to be sure to be as close as possible to their idol once the show started. “There are already a few people there. Some have arrived more than a month and a half ago, which is my case,” confided a spectator to BFMTV.

As if to thank her fans for having waited a long time, the singer gave them a little surprise a few hours before the show, by deciding to come and meet them. On social networks, the lucky ones shared videos of this unexpected moment, accompanied by comments which testify to their immense joy. In the images, we see Mylène Farmer walking along the stadium and greeting the spectators already present. “Little appearance before the big night,” comments a user on X. “I can die in peace,” declares another.
